By: Spencer Eidsmoe and Josh Secord Hank Aaron The barrier is broken By: Spencer Eidsmoe and Josh Secord

One letter said that he would be the most hated man if he broke Babe Ruth's home run record One fact that we found was that Hank Aaron received three thousand letters a day threatening to kill him and his family. Hank Aaron said “there is no way to measure the affect that those letters had on me but I like to think that every one of them added a home run to my total.” Hank Aaron wrote book I had a Hammer

He was born on the 5th of February in 1934. He was born in Mobile Alabama. He played for the Atlanta Braves. His real name was Henry Aaron. He hit seven hundred and fifty five home runs the previous record was seven hundred and fourteen.

Hank Aaron went to college at the Allen Institute, Seattle Washington Hank Aaron went to college at the Allen Institute, Seattle Washington. Graduated in 1951. In the negro league he played for the Indianapolis Clowns. Hank Aaron had seven siblings.

Hank Aaron helped break the color barrier because he showed the fans of major league baseball that a black player could be just as good at baseball as a white ones.
